Macy's

Macy's is an American department store chain, and its flagship store in Herald Square is regarded as one of the largest stores in the United States. It has a broad selection of items, including clothes and footwear accessories, cosmetics, and home products. The company has several other stores across the nation in addition to its main store in the city of.

Rowland Hussey Macy opened a department store in New York City in the 1800s. Macy is credited with many innovations that have transformed the department store as we see it today, including the use of cash-only transactions and establishing an unbeatable shopping system. He was also the first retailer to offer money-back guarantees and standardize newspaper prices in the US. He also developed a custom-made to measure clothing operation and the Christmas window display which remains a Macy's tradition today.

Macy's is well-known for its haute couture and is committed to providing an multichannel experience. Terry Lundgren, the company's president, describes its customer as "a sophisticated and intelligent customer who is active on smartphones and social media". This is why Macy's is trying to let customers interact with the store in any way they prefer from in-store to online, and even mobile apps.

In an effort to compete with e-commerce, Macy's began testing new concepts, such as Story. This concept involves rotating pop-up stores within the store, allowing customers to see and feel products before making a final decision. The company also offers a click-and collect service that lets customers pick up their purchase in-store without needing to go through the checkout.

In the 1990s Macy's expanded into suburban shopping centres and became a major retailer. It now has more than 850 outlets. Macy's also launched a rebranding initiative, which included the introduction of all stores of the name Macy's. The company also revamped the Thanksgiving Day Parade, which was broadcast on NBC across the nation. It was a huge success and helped the company gain recognition. After the relaunch, series of marketing partnerships were forged with popular brands and celebrities, including actress Sarah Jessica Parker.

Nordstrom

Nordstrom is a department store that offers fashionable clothing and accessories for men, women as well as children and infants. The company's headquarters are in Seattle, Washington and operates a chain across the US. The company offers online shopping as well as an application for mobile phones. The products offered by the company include clothing and shoes, handbags and accessories such as bath and body products, home accents and accents as along with cosmetics and food items. Nordstrom offers a variety of services, including styling, alteration orders pickups, and dining services. It also operates the retail brand Zella.

Nordstrom's online sales are more than 30% of the company's total revenue. The retailer aims to offer an experience that is as close as possible to the Nordstrom in-store experience. The Nordstrom website and its apps utilize data to customize the user's experience. For example the Nordstrom app displays products that are a good fit for the buyer. It also suggests items that may be interesting. It also lets customers add items to the Wish List for later purchase.

The Nordstrom app is simple to navigate and features various styles, including the latest dresses. The Nordstrom app offers dresses from designers like Rachel Zoe Jill Scott and Tory Burch. The site also stocks classics from brands like Ann Taylor, Talbots, and Banana Republic. The site also has many styles for every occasion such as a night out to weddings.

In contrast to other retailers, Nordstrom's return policy isn't limited in time. If the item you purchased isn't right for you or the color, you are able to return it with no hassle. Nordstrom will replace the item or refund you. Fashion-conscious customers who don't want to return their dress may take advantage of this option.

Nordstrom has earned a reputation for offering high-end, personalized service to its customers. It has an upscale image and offers a unique shopping experience that is more than just buying clothes. Its loyalty program is a great method to earn rewards and benefits for frequent customers.
